Having difficulty with your car 's key fob distance ? Never fret! Smart key repeaters, also known as key signal amplifiers, offer a simple fix to boost your keyless entry . These small devices capture the weak signal from your key fob and then relay it to your car , effectively increasing the effective range. This can be particularly beneficial in situations where barriers like thick walls or other equipment are interfering the signal, ensuring reliable keyless operation.

What Exactly Is a Smart Key? Explained
A key fob is more than just a replacement for a traditional metal car key. It's a advanced electronic device that combines remote communication with features for car access and startup control. These modern keys typically include a electronic component that communicates with the automobile's computer system, allowing for push-button entry and remote operation of the power unit. Some include additional amenities like wireless locking and unlocking , and even the ability to pinpoint the car if it’s misplaced.
